MAC-CALCULUS
MAC 1101 Principles of Algebra . . . . . 3(3,0)
In this course, emphasis is placed on the principles and techniques of elementary algebra including properties of numbers, linear and quadratic equations, inequalities, polynomials in one and two variables, graphs, rational algebraic expressions, systems of linear equations, functions, roots, and radicals. Credit toward Gordon Rule may not be earned in MAC 1101. Prerequisite: Appropriate score on placement test.
MAC 1103C College Algebra with Laboratory . . . . . 4(3,3)
A laboratory intensive college algebra course to cover topics including: exponents, radicals, complex numbers, polynomials, functions and graphs, exponential and logarithmic functions, systems of equations. Students may earn only 3 semester hours credit toward Gordon Rule for combinations of either MAC 1103C and MAC 1140 or MAC 1104 and MAC 1140. Prerequisite: Appropriate score on placement test or MAC 1101 or equivalent.
MAC 1104 College Algebra . . . . . 3(3,0)
Basic logic, polynomials, functions and relations, exponentials and logarithms, inverse functions, basic conic sections, binomial theorem, permutations, combinations, introduction to probability, simultaneous equations. Students may earn only 3 semester hours credit toward Gordon Rule for combinations of either MAC 1103C and MAC 1140 or MAC 1104 and MAC 1140. Prerequisite: Appropriate score on placement test or MAC 1101 or equivalent.
MAC 1113 Trigonometry . . . . . 2(2,0)
Trigonometric functions, triangle trigonometry, laws of sines and cosines, special formulas, trigonometric identities, complex numbers and polar representation. Prerequisite: College algebra or a strong high school algebra background.
MAC 1140 Precalculus Algebra . . . . . 3(3,0)
Functions, algebraic expressions, polynomials, graphs, systems of equations, exponents and logarithms, matrices and determinants, mathematical proof. Students may earn only 3 semester hours credit toward Gordon Rule for combinations of either MAC 1103C and MAC 1140 or MAC 1104 and MAC 1140. Prerequisite: Appropriate score on placement test or grade of ̉CÓ or better in MAC 1101.
1MAC 3233 Calculus with Business Applications . . . . . 3(3,0)
Sets and functions; derivatives; areas under a curve; integration; exponentials and logarithms; applications of derivatives and integrals. Prerequisite: MAC 1140.
2MAC 3311 Analytic Geometry and Calculus I . . . . . 4(4,0)
Introductory topics through differentiation and integration of algebraic functions and applications. Prerequisite: MAC 1113 and MAC 1140 or equivalent.
2MAC 3312 Analytic Geometry and Calculus II . . . . . 4(4,0)
Continuation of MAC 3311. Transcendental functions, methods of integration, further analytic geometry and applications. Prerequisite: MAC 3311.
2MAC 3313 Analytic Geometry and Calculus III . . . . . 4(4,0)
Partial differentiation, multiple integration, infinite series. Prerequisite: MAC 3312.
